Three General
Rules for Set
Points

1. Set Points activate at the set point plus

the preact.

2. Set Points deactivate at the set point plus

the deadband.

3. The deaband should be numerically

larger than the preact.

Preact Limits

1. The preact value is the number of units

below or above the set point at which the
relay will trip.

2. The preact value is used as an “in-flight”

compensation value when filling a ves-
sel. If set to zero, there will be no com-
pensation.
